Voting from 7 am to 5 pm at 11,348 polling stations across Delhi 1.1 crore electors eligible
The Meteorological department has predicted a maximum temperature of 38 degrees Celsius on Thursday
* Electors required to carry electronic photo identity cards. Those without photo ID should carry alternative documents for identification:
* Passport
* Driving licence
* Income tax identity cards
* Service identity cards (with photo) issued to employees of State/Central government,public sector undertakings,local bodies,public limited companies. These should be photo identity cards.
* Passbooks of public sector banks/post office and kisan passbooks with photo.
* Job cards issued under NREGA
* Voter assistance booths being set up at all polling premises with more than 2 polling stations to assist people in ascertaining their serial number and part number of electoral roll containing name

To beat the heat,the election office has made the following arrangements:
* Drinking water facility at polling premises
* Each polling party being supplied with ORS to tackle problems of dehydration
* Electors advised to carry wet towels to protect themselves against heat and dehydration,and not bring children to polling stations
* Ramps provided at polling stations for the disabled
* Returning officers advised to make separate lines for senior citizens and physically challenged persons
* Delhi Metro to start trains at 4 am
